All you have to do is look at the nutritional info of everything u put in. Add it up, then divide all of what u made into however many servings you would like. Divide the macronutrients by that number. For instance, if I make a bowl of tuna salad that contains 120g fat, 36g carbs, and 300g protein from all my ingredients. If I then divide it into 6 servings each meal would contain 20g fat, 6g carbs, 50g protein. Even though this may not be EXACTLY correct it won’t make a huge difference.
